Hi all,

After upgrading to Yosemite I have a funny thing going on. In my "notes" app my iCloud account is logged in twice and it shows double notes. When I disable syncing for notes in iCloud setting only one shows.

I can't figure out how to disable the "other" one

This is very strange.

Anyone knows how to fix this?

I managed to duplicate my earlier fix after messing around a bit! :D

  1. Quit Notes app
  2. Go to System Preferences > iCloud
  3. Uncheck "Notes"
  4. Quit System Preferences
  5. Launch Notes app again and notice how only one iCloud folder is still visible
  6. Make changes to a random note and give it time to sync (yes, it will still sync)
  7. Go back to System Preferences > iCloud
  8. "Notes" is checked automatically, correcting the problem

I found a solution!

I signed out of my iCloud account on my laptop, did a restart & signed back in. Now only one iCloud account shows up.

Thank God I tried that because I was about to do a clean install again :)

Anyone who still has that problem, please try that.
